A minor earthquake magnitude 3.13 (ml/mb) has occurred on Thursday, 82 km NW of Aguadilla, Puerto Rico (51 miles). The epicenter of the earthquake was roughly 18 km (11 miles) below the earth’s surface. Id of earthquake: pr2019346009. Event ids that are associated: pr2019346009. The 3.13-magnitude earthquake was detected at 06:22:52 / 6:22 am (local time epicenter). Exact location, longitude -67.6988° West, latitude 18.9675° North, depth = 18 km. Date and time of earthquake in UTC/GMT: 12/12/19 / 2019-12-12 11:22:52 / December 12, 2019 @ 11:22 am.
In the past 24 hours, there have been five, in the last 10 days thirty-five, in the past 30 days ninety-six and in the last 365 days eight hundred and ninety-seven earthquakes of magnitude 3.0 or greater that have been detected nearby.
